  • PIC FROM Kennedy News and Media (PICTURED: FIONA HOOKER'S PREGNANT STOMACH AT THE BEGINNING OF HER PEMPHIGOID GESTATIONIS FLARE UP) A mum who erupted in agonising blisters and welts all over her body was stunned to discover she was 'allergic' to her own BABY. Fiona Hooker, from Basingstoke, Hampshire, first noticed itchy red areas on her stomach at 31 weeks pregnant, which she says felt like 'nettle stings' and got progressively worse. After suffering through the remainder of her pregnancy covered in 'unbearable red itchy plaques' on her skin, the 32-year-old says the condition 'exploded' into incredibly painful blisters once she gave birth.     11 /12 Die erschreckende Diagnose wurde Tage nach der Geburt mittels Bluttest bestätigt: Pemphigoid gestationis. Die Ärzte vermuten, dass die Reaktion durch ein Gen in der DNA ihres Sohnes ausgelöst worden, da sie in ihrer ersten Schwangerschaft mit ihrer mittlerweile dreijährigen Tochter Phoebe nicht an dieser Krankheit litt, so die Britin.
